Axial movement of the crankshaft is controlled by two half thrust washer position both side of centre main bearing. In this work tribological behavior of aluminum base and copper base material of crankshaft thrust washer studied. The aim of the research presented in this paper is focused on finding out the wear and coefficient of friction of bearing materials under lubricated conditions and suggest the suitability of the thrust washer bearing material fitted to the crankshaft. The Aluminum and Copper base bearing material is to be tested two loads and three critical speeds for a governed period of time. The results obtained from the experiment are analyzed and the effect of load and speed on both the bearing materials along with wear trends obtained with respect to time is analyzed and best thrust washer bearing material is chosen. |
